(KNZA)--Brown County is moving into the 2nd phase of COVID-19 vaccinations.
The Brown County Health Department, in a release posted on their Facebook page, said that the county has received a very limited amount of vaccine at this time.
The Health Department in conjunction with the Hiawatha Community Hospital and Brown County Emergency Management are collecting names for Phase 2. They will then prioritize the list by age and contact each individual to schedule an appointment.
Those eligible to receive the vaccine in Phase 2 include those age 65 and older and high contact critical workers such as first responders and teachers.
To help identify those wanting a vaccine, your ask to complete an online survey.
